How does Silver Diamine Fluoride protect my teeth?

For those looking to prevent dental decay and maintain healthy teeth, Silver Diamine Fluoride (SDF) is a powerful tool. Unlike other forms of fluoride, SDF works in two distinct ways: first, it actively fights the bacteria that produce cavities; and second, it serves as a self-contained protective layer to keep those cavity-causing bacteria away. And because SDF contains antibacterial silver particles, it can ward off even more types of bacteria than just traditional fluoride treatments. Additionally, SDF is incredibly convenient - you can get all the decay-preventing benefits of a fluoride treatment without enduring the taste or need for endless rinsing and swishing that comes with other treatments. Overall, Silver Diamine Fluoride is an excellent way to care for your teeth and protect them from potentially debilitating cavities.

At What Age Should I Receive Fluoride Treatments?

When it comes to choosing the right age for receiving fluoridated treatments, there is no one-size-fits-all answer. Most dentists recommend starting fluoride treatments at a young age, around when your child’s permanent teeth start coming in. This timeline should not be restricted to only children though! Adults can benefit from fluoride treatments just as much. There are various forms of treatment available, including concentrated fluoride toothpastes and mouth rinses, as well as professionally applied varnishes and gels. Additionally, many municipal water supplies contain fluoride, so checking with your local water authority is also a great way to supplement your child’s oral care routine. All in all, protecting our teeth from cavities is important at any point in life and certain types of fluoride treatments can create a lasting impact for both adults and children alike.
